Influence of globally spin-aligned vector mesons to the measurements of the chiral magnetic effect in heavy-ion collisions
The chiral magnetic effect (CME) in high-energy heavy-ion collisions arises from the interplay between the chirality imbalance and the intense magnetic field and will cause a charge separation along the magnetic field direction.
